So I have 2 instances with card decline.
I have my business bank account linked to quickbooks. I went to purchase items to resell and my business debit card declined. So I ended up using my personal debit card to make the purchase. I did make a journal entry to show I spend x amount for cost of goods sold and that it was an owner investment. How do I categorize the bank transactions on my business account that declined? I didn’t create any bills within quickbooks, I tried matching the transaction with the journal entry I created, but it won’t come up after I click the match button
another instance I have is where my business card declined for an online subscription I was using. I ended up canceling the subscription before any payment went through. So how do I categorize that declined transaction in the bank transaction feed?

If the declined payment originates from a different account and the journal entry is recorded in other accounts, they cannot be matched.
Regarding the categorization of bank transactions for your business account and the declined transaction for your online subscription, you can exclude the decline purchase since it doesn't affect your bank balance.
